What Affects Residential & Commercial Roofing Costs in North Little Rock?

Understanding pricing factors helps you budget accurately and avoid surprises

📊

labor costs

Labor rates in North Little Rock reflect the area's affordable living costs and steady construction demand. Experienced crews charge more for quality work, especially on steep or complex roofs. Rates can fluctuate with crew availability.

📊

market dynamics

Pulaski County's weather-prone location drives demand after hail or wind events, pushing prices up temporarily. Competition from Little Rock-area roofers helps keep baseline costs competitive. Supply chain for materials like shingles affects overall pricing.

📊

seasonal trends

Spring and fall storm seasons increase urgency and costs. Summer heat may slow installs, while milder winters offer better rates for planned work.

🧱 Key Pricing Components

  • Roof size and pitch - Larger or steeper roofs require more time and safety measures.
  • Material type - Asphalt shingles are common and economical; metal or tile add premium costs.
  • Old roof removal - Tearing off multiple layers increases labor and disposal fees.
  • Extras like underlayment, flashing, and ventilation - Essential for longevity.
  • Permits and inspections - Required in Pulaski County.
  • Residential vs. commercial - Commercial often higher due to scale and regulations.

⚠️ Watch Out For

Pricing Red Flags

Warning Sign

Unusually low quotes - May signal subpar materials or unlicensed work.

Warning Sign

No written contract or missing details on scope.

Warning Sign

Pressure tactics like 'limited time offer' post-storm.

Warning Sign

Large upfront payments - Stick to 10-20% deposits.

Warning Sign

Hidden fees for disposal, permits, or travel.

Pricing Questions

Common questions about residential & commercial roofing costs in North Little Rock

💬 What drives roofing costs most in North Little Rock?

Roof size, pitch, material choice, and damage extent top the list. Local storms common in Arkansas amplify repair needs.

Commercial projects add costs for height, access, and compliance.

💬 How do residential and commercial roofing prices compare?

Residential focuses on standard homes with moderate scales. Commercial handles bigger roofs, heavier regulations, and safety gear—often costing more per square foot.

Always specify your needs upfront.

💬 When do roofing prices peak in this area?

After severe weather like hail storms in spring/fall. Demand surges, straining labor and materials.

Off-peak winter can offer savings for non-emergencies.

💬 How long to get a roofing quote locally?

Reputable pros provide quotes in 1-3 days after site visit. Free estimates are standard.

Rush jobs post-storm may take longer.

💬 What extras should I budget for?

Permits, disposal, and upgrades like better ventilation. These can add 10-20%.

Confirm inclusions to avoid surprises.

💬 Does price include warranties?

Good quotes specify material and labor warranties—often 10-50 years on shingles.

Cheap bids may skimp here; ask directly.
